Chairman of the Center for Right and Freedom and Coordinator of the Committee for the Protection of Political Prisoners and Persecuted People, has addressed a letter to PACE Co-rapporteur on Armenia Axel Fischer.

In the letter, Vardan Harutyunyan urges PACE to help release the political prisoners in Armenia.

"The primary task of the co-rapporteurs is to provide accurate and unbiased information. I am hopeful that PACE will abandon the practice of using double standards and will use its entire potential to turn Armenia into a democratic country where there are no political prisoners and political repression.

We understand that establishment of democracy is the first and foremost task of the Armenian people. We do not ask you to fight for us. We are hopeful that our people will succeed in their endeavors one day.
However, we are convinced that the protection of human rights is everybody's task irrespective of one's nationality and place of residence.

We expect PACE to remain committed to its mandate and resolutions.

Human rights and dignity are vital issues and we must do everything possible to exclude the existence of political prisoners in Belarus, Russia, Iran, Armenia Cuba and elsewhere.

We believe that you will do your utmost to release the political prisoners languishing in Armenian prisons for three years," reads the letter.
